Marvel at the Himalayas without the strain on the "Everest View Trek." Designed as an easy trek, it invites travelers of all ages and fitness levels to soak in panoramic views of Everest, Ama Dablam, Lhotse, and Nuptse. Meander through lush forests, cross suspension bridges draped with prayer flags, and immerse yourself in Sherpa culture in villages like Namche Bazaar and Khumjung. Visit ancient monasteries, stroll along stone-paved streets, and interact with welcoming locals. The tour’s unique selling point is its accessibility: this trekking package offers all the grandeur of the Everest region—cultural richness, dramatic landscapes, and legendary peaks—without the risk of altitude sickness or the need for strenuous effort, making it an outstanding choice for those seeking a gentle Himalayan adventure.

Day 1Kathmandu - Lukla - Phakding (2,652 m/8,700 ft)
Day 2Phakding - Namche Bazaar (3440 m/11,280 ft)
Day 3Rest day at Namche Bazaar
Day 4Namche Bazzar to Tengboche (3860 m/12,660 ft)
Day 5Trek back to Khumjung to Jorsale (2,740 m/8987 ft)
Day 6Jorsale to Lukla
Day 7Fly back Lukla to Kathmandu

What's Included

Airport and hotel transfers as per itinerary and for arrival and departureRound trip flight Kathmandu – Lukla– Kathmandu including departure taxesTIMS, Everest National Park PermitsMeals (breakfast, lunch and dinner) during the trekTeahouse/lodge accommodation (twin sharing) during the trek (we provide rooms with private bathrooms and hot shower at Phakding, Namche and Lukla)One professional, knowledgeable and friendly English speaking trekking guide including his salary, food, accomodation, equipment, insurance, etcPorter (1 porter for each 2 trekkers) including his salary, food, accomodation, equipment, insurance, etcDuffle bag, sleeping bag, and down jacket for use during the trekIcicles Adventure T – shirt, trekking map and trip achievement certificateFirst aid medical kitAll government taxes & office service charge

This trek was amazing! It is listed as easy, and it is in terms of a relatively untrained person can definitely complete the trek, however for that person it is pretty difficult. Definitely worth it, and a huge feeling of accomplishment at the end! It was a great starting out trek rather than going all the way to base camp, but still with magnificent views of Everest and surrounding mountains. The tea lodges and accomodation along the way were comfortable, nice people and good food. I travelled in winter and although mronibgs and evenings were cold, walking during the day was warm and the lodges were cozy. Winter also made for completely clear skies and beautiful weather.
